But the majority do not watch over the hatching or the growth of their
larvæ. They are forced therefore to lay up a store of food beforehand.
They know this, and are not found wanting. But here they are confronted
by a most difficult problem. If the prey carried to the nest is dead,
it will quickly putrefy; it cannot possibly keep fresh, as it must, for
the weeks and months of the larva’s growth. If it is alive it cannot
easily be seized by the larvæ, and will represent a menace or even a
deadly danger. The Wasp must discover the secret of producing, in her
victims, the immobility of death together with the incorruptibility of
life. And the Wasps have discovered this secret, for the prey which
they provide for their larvæ remain at their disposal to the end
without movement and without deterioration. Do these tiny creatures
know intuitively the secrets of asepsis which Pasteur discovered with
so much difficulty? Such was the conclusion with which Dufour was
forced to content himself. He presumed the existence, in the Hunting
Wasps, of a virus which was at once a weapon of the chase and a liquid
preservative, for the immolation and conservation of the victims. But
even if aseptic a dead insect would shrivel up into a mummy. Now this
must not occur, and as a matter of fact the Wasp’s victims remain moist
indefinitely, just as if alive. And in reality they are not dead; they
are still alive. Fabre has demonstrated this by proving the persistence
of the organic functions, and by feeding some of them by hand. In
short, it is incontestable that the victims are not put to death but
merely deprived of movement, smitten with paralysis. How has this
result, more miraculous even than asepsis, been obtained by the insect?
By the procedure that the most skilful physiologist would employ. By
plunging its sting into the victim’s body, not at random, which might
kill it, but at certain definite points, exactly where the invisible
nervous ganglia are located which control the various movements.
For the rest, the operative method varies according to the species and
anatomy of the victim.
In his investigation of the paralysers, Dufour was unable to imagine
any other weapon of the chase than the mere inoculation of a deadly
virus; the Hymenopteron has invented a means of immobilising her victim
without killing it, of abolishing its movements without destroying its
organic functions, of dissociating the nervous system of the vegetative
life from that of the life of reaction; to spare the first while
annihilating the second, by the precise adaptation of this delicate
surgery to the victim’s anatomy and physiology. Dufour was unable to
provide anything better for the larva’s larder than mummified victims,
shrivelled and more or less flavourless; the Hymenopteron provided them
with living prey, endowed with the strange prerogative of keeping fresh
indefinitely without food and without movement, thanks to paralysis,
far superior in this connection to asepsis.
